BREAKING: Carbon Tax to End Tomorrow with New Cabinet
PM Carney promised his government will immediately remove the carbon tax.
Sec. 166 of the Greenhouse Gas Pollution Pricing Act gives Cabinet the authority to eliminate the carbon tax through an Order in Council.
With his new Cabinet being sworn in tomorrow (March 14th), our new PM can convene an immediate Cabinet meeting to honour his clear commitment to “immediately remove the consumer carbon tax”.
